Hallo!
1.) Formular
Zun�chst muss Du sicherstellen, dass das Formular die Zeilenumbr�che
auch zum Server schickt:
<textarea ... wrap=physical>
2.) Datenbank schreiben
�ffne die Tabelle mit einem leeren Recordset und f�ge dann die Felder
mit AddNew und Parametern hinzu:
dim dbFields: dbFields = array("news_titel", "news_datum",
"news_info_kurz", "news_info_lang")
dim dbValues(3)
for i = 0 to ubound(dbFields): dbValues =
cstr(Request.Form(dbFields(i))): next
rs.Open "select * from ... where id = 0", db, adOpenStatic,
adLockOptimistic, adCmdText
rs.AddNew dbFields, dbValues
rs.Close
3.) Datenbank lesen
Die Datenfelder enthalten jetzt ggf. Zeilenumbr�che, die werden in HTML
aber ignoriert, es sei denn, Du ersetzt sie durch "<br>":
Response.Write replace(rs("news_info_lang"), vbCrLf, "<br>")
Freundliche Gr��e
Joachim van de Bruck
> -----Urspr�ngliche Nachricht-----
> Von: gray conn [mailto:[EMAIL PROTECTED]]
> Gesendet: Mittwoch, 3. Oktober 2001 14:12
> An: ASP Datenbankprogrammierung
> Betreff: [aspdedatabase] Re: [aspdedatabase] AW: [aspdedatabase]
zeilenumbruch von datenbank
> eintr�gen
>
>
> hallo
>
> besten dank f�r deine hilfe, leider bin ich nicht so der beste
edv-crack
>
> kannst du mir weiterhelfen. wie du das meinst
>
> besten dank gray
>
>
> habe unten den code:
>
> <form name="form1" method="POST" action="<%=MM_editAction%>">
> <table width="550" border="0" cellspacing="0" cellpadding="2"
> align="center">
> <tr>
> <td> </td>
> <td align="right">
> <h1>News übermitteln</h1>
> </td>
> </tr>
> <tr>
> <td class="weiss" valign="top">Titel:</td>
> <td>
> <input type="text" name="news_titel" size="35">
> </td>
> </tr>
> <tr>
> <td class="weiss" valign="top">Datum:</td>
> <td>
> <input type="text" name="news_datum" size="35">
> </td>
> </tr>
> <tr>
> <td class="weiss" valign="top">Kurzinfo:</td>
> <td>
> <textarea name="news_info_kurz" cols="35" rows="3"></textarea>
> </td>
> </tr>
> <tr>
> <td class="weiss" valign="top">Langinfo:</td>
> <td>
> <textarea name="news_info_lang" cols="35" rows="8"></textarea>
> </td>
> </tr>
> <tr>
> <td> </td>
> <td>
> <input type="submit" name="Abschicken" value="Abschicken">
> <input type="reset" name="Abschicken2"
value="Zurücksetzen">
> </td>
> </tr>
> </table>
> <input type="hidden" name="MM_insert" value="true">
> </form>
>
>
>
>
>
> > probier mal
> >
> > replace(deinfeld,vbcrlf,"<br>")
> >
> > mfg
> >
> > Martin
> >
> > -----Urspr�ngliche Nachricht-----
> > Von: gray conn [mailto:[EMAIL PROTECTED]]
> > Gesendet: Mittwoch, 03. Oktober 2001 14:00
> > An: ASP Datenbankprogrammierung
> > Betreff: [aspdedatabase] zeilenumbruch von datenbank eintr�gen
> >
> >
> > hallo zusammen
> >
> > Ich habe folgendes Problem.
> > Ich schreibe mit einer Insert-Seite Datens�tze in eine sql-DB. Auf
der
> > Insert-Seite schreibe ich Daten mit Enter (als Zeilenumbruch)in ein
> > mehrzeiliges
> > Textfeld. Beim auslesen mit einer Detailseite bringt er mir keine
> > Zeilenumbr�che mehr. Was mach ich faschlt?
> >
> >
> > Danke im voraus
> >
> > gray
> >
> > --
> > GMX - Die Kommunikationsplattform im Internet.
> > http://www.gmx.net
> >
> >
> > | [aspdedatabase] als [EMAIL PROTECTED] subscribed
> > | http://www.aspgerman.com/archiv/aspdedatabase/ = Listenarchiv
> > | Sie k�nnen sich unter folgender URL an- und abmelden:
> > |
http://www.aspgerman.com/aspgerman/listen/anmelden/aspdedatabase.asp
> >
> >
> > | [aspdedatabase] als [EMAIL PROTECTED] subscribed
> > | http://www.aspgerman.com/archiv/aspdedatabase/ = Listenarchiv
> > | Sie k�nnen sich unter folgender URL an- und abmelden:
> > |
http://www.aspgerman.com/aspgerman/listen/anmelden/aspdedatabase.asp
> >
>
> --
> GMX - Die Kommunikationsplattform im Internet.
> http://www.gmx.net
>
>
> | [aspdedatabase] als [EMAIL PROTECTED] subscribed
> | http://www.aspgerman.com/archiv/aspdedatabase/ = Listenarchiv
> | Sie k�nnen sich unter folgender URL an- und abmelden:
> | http://www.aspgerman.com/aspgerman/listen/anmelden/aspdedatabase.asp
| [aspdedatabase] als [email protected] subscribed
| http://www.aspgerman.com/archiv/aspdedatabase/ = Listenarchiv
| Sie k�nnen sich unter folgender URL an- und abmelden:
| http://www.aspgerman.com/aspgerman/listen/anmelden/aspdedatabase.asp